The combination of regorafenib and rosiglitazone is an investigational therapeutic regimen being evaluated for the treatment of advanced solid tumors. Regorafenib is a potent multi-kinase inhibitor that targets several pathways involved in tumor angiogenesis (VEGFR1, VEGFR2, VEGFR3, TIE2), oncogenesis (KIT, RET, RAF-1, BRAF), and the tumor microenvironment (PDGFR, FGFR). Rosiglitazone is a peroxisome proliferator-activated receptor gamma (PPARγ) agonist, traditionally used as an antidiabetic agent, which has demonstrated the ability to induce cell cycle arrest and promote differentiation in various cancer cell lines. Preclinical research suggests that PPARγ activation may sensitize tumor cells to the effects of kinase inhibitors like regorafenib, potentially overcoming resistance mechanisms and enhancing anti-tumor efficacy. This combination has been studied in Phase 1 clinical trials to assess safety, tolerability, and the maximum tolerated dose in patients with refractory solid malignancies.
